78. Helen pops in for a festive game with a Kiwi twist

After a busy year, which saw Steve team up with Lord James Bethell for chapter three of THE health and politics podcast, it's time for some festive fun as an old friend joins.


Original co-host, Dr Helen Stokes-Lampard, dials in from her home in New Zealand to play a special game of snap with a Kiwi twist - Yeh / Yeh-Nah - which looks at the current similarities between the two countries in health and politics. Discussion ranges from health service reorganisation and workforce strife to public health outbreaks.


And Pod Surgery makes a one-off return as the pair discuss the flu epidemic hitting England's hospitals and whether it really did come from the southern hemisphere?
